Overview and context

Control boards in Maytag stoves govern user input, oven preheat, bake and broil functions, and safety interlocks. When symptoms like unresponsive controls, erratic temperatures, or display failures occur, a faulty board is a common culprit-but it's essential to rule out wiring, door switches, and sensor issues first. Replacement boards have evolved from simple, discrete modules to integrated assemblies that may require calibration or reprogramming to restore full functionality.

Identifying the correct motherboard

To minimize misfires and mismatches, you must determine the exact model family and part number. The model number sits on a label inside the door frame or on the back of the appliance, and it guides you to the precise control board version. A board designed for one model can have different connector layouts, voltage expectations, or firmware that won't communicate with another model's keypad or sensors.

  • Check the model and serial numbers on the appliance label.
  • Note the control board part number if visible on the current board.
  • Record symptoms: unresponsive keypad, display errors, failure of bake/broil modes, or intermittent heating.

Where to source the correct board

Authorized parts dealers and reputable repair vendors offer replacement control boards that are clearly labeled for specific Maytag models. The right shop will provide a compatibility lookup and confirmation of wiring harness compatibility, edge connector alignment, and required firmware or calibration steps. Be wary of generic boards that claim universal fit; these are unlikely to deliver long-term reliability in a Maytag stove with digital controls.

  1. Use the model lookup tool on an official or trusted parts site to locate the exact control board for your model.
  2. Confirm the board includes the same connector count and orientation as your existing unit.
  3. Review return policy and warranty, ideally 90 days or more, to cover misfit or software issues.

Common symptoms pointing to the control board

Board failures often present as one or more of the following: unresponsive front panel, random or no heating, inconsistent temperatures, display blackout or glitches, or failure to enter preset modes. Some boards display error codes that reference the control circuit rather than a heating element fault. It's advisable to verify power supply stability, check for loose connectors, and reseat harnesses before concluding the board is at fault.

Symptom Likely Board-Related Cause Recommended Action
Display is blank or shows random codes Control board communication fault Power cycle, reseat connectors, replace board if codes persist
Oven not heating, but bake light on sends incorrect heating commands Test wiring to elements; replace board if power to elements remains inconsistent
Unresponsive keypad Interface-to-board signaling failure Inspect keypad ribbon and connectors; replace board if signals don't register
Erratic temperature control Firmware/EEPROM miscommunication Board replacement and reprogramming per model instructions

Replacement steps: a practical roadmap

Follow model-specific instructions to minimize risk. Always disconnect power before starting any repair. The steps below reflect a typical installation sequence but must be adapted to your exact Maytag model:

  1. Power off and unplug the unit; lock the anti-tip mechanism if present to ensure safe access.
  2. Access the control board by removing the range back panel or the control panel bezel according to the service manual for your model.
  3. Carefully disconnect all harness connectors from the old board; photograph or label the harnesses to ensure proper reattachment to the new board.
  4. Remove mounting screws and lift the old board away; inspect the surrounding area for burn marks or melted connectors.
  5. Install the new control board, align it with mounting holes, and reattach all harness connectors exactly as labeled or photographed.
  6. Reassemble the control panel or back cover; plug the range back in and perform a power-on reset (often a 30-second unplug/plug cycle).
  7. Program or code-calibrate the new board if required by the model; verify keypad responsiveness and oven temperature accuracy in a test bake cycle.

Testing and calibration after installation

After replacement, run a series of functional tests to ensure the board operates the oven and controls correctly. A typical test sequence includes powering on, selecting bake and broil, setting temperatures, and monitoring preheat times. If the display shows error codes, consult the manual and replace or reseat connectors as needed before calling a technician.
